The table came well packaged in a nested box with thick cardboard and plenty of foam packing material. Everything was individually bagged to prevent scratching and wear during transport. The table top surface also had a sheet of plastic film attached for protection. My husband wrote up this review:Instructions were clear and easy to understand. Assembly was a breeze (mostly, see below) with the included set-screws and allen wrench. The only issue was related to the threaded holes that the set-screws fit in to, which hold the legs in rings on the shelf and sockets in the tabletop. It looks like there was not a lot of quality control in the thread cutting process for those holes. Each hole has sharp burrs around the edge (watch your fingers) and some of the burrs make it difficult to get the screw threads started. I was able to get all but one screw in easily after getting the thread started. The last one got cross-threaded after several attempts.The table design is very well thought out, with an adjustable center shelf and reinforced tabletop. Each leg has a plastic foot insert on the bottom, which can be screwed in and out to level the table. Speaking of leveling, when you install the shelf, due to the way it is attached to the legs, you may need to do a bit of leveling before you tighten the set-screws down all the way.Besides the quality control issue with the hole threads, there was really only one other issue. One of the shelf welds was pretty bad (see pic), which I’m guessing was probably just a fluke with my table and not the norm. The botched weld did not affect performance at all, so it’s not that big of a deal for me, but I thought it was probably worth mentioning. I will probably reinforce that weld at some point.In the short term we are using this table to house our laser engraver, and it works great for that purpose. The long term plan for this table is to use it for shipping & receiving. Due to its strength, I believe it will be perfect for this use.All in all, this is a great table, and I’m looking forward to getting many years of use out of it. I totally recommend.
